Paper Abstract:
Discusses various types of structures. How companies can determine which structure is appropriate. Vertical organization as a hierarchical division of labor. Horizontal organization and greater employee autonomy. Functional specialization. Divisional Departmentation. Matrix Departmentation. Hybrid form of structure. Advantages and disadvantages of different structures.

INTRODUCTION The structure of any particular company can determine the level of success that the company enjoys in the market. There are various types of structures, including vertical, horizontal and matrix, which can be used to organize a company, but no singularly correct structure for every company. In fact, most companies should regularly review their organizational structure to determine if they are organized in the most efficient manner possible for their current and anticipated business environment. Company X has not undertaken such a review in many years, and faces the challenge of implementing significant change throughout the organization in order to achieve the best possible structure for today's business environment.
